In this advanced course, students give two PowerPoint presentations on their research on two selected cutting-edge/current Deaf Studies topics, and are assessed on itemized public speaking skills, grammatical features (linguistics) studies that are a culmination of previous ASL courses, and pragmatic language functions. These presentations are to use high/academic register, appropriate for a large academic audience, demonstrating sensitive awareness of visual acuity and its impact on signing production. Prereq: ASL 621. Lab.

Additional Course Details:
If students’ previous ASL courses have not been through UNH Manchester, they will need to schedule a language assessment prior to enrolling in this. The assessment is used to determine course placement based on language competency demonstrated. Contact Laurie Shaffer for how to schedule an assessment.
